Transaction 8d834938bfc66d77cbdf578d7eb27d9a05414accb6f1e50ddee1e5bccd37e367

2 Input
2 Outputs
  • 8d834938bfc66d77cbdf578d7eb27d9a05414accb6f1e50ddee1e5bccd37e367:0
  • value  200860
    address  17s4zu7zuwwJJqcZej6UJ4jPgsznKH6f62
  • 8d834938bfc66d77cbdf578d7eb27d9a05414accb6f1e50ddee1e5bccd37e367:1
  • value  1059684
    address  3H5fgowBzBGvVBgZVL8jajxmBAYRyjjcM9